LINUX.ORG.RU

make kernel


0

0

Hello.

Вопрос от того, что доки не дочитал, наверно. Помогите разобраться. Для компиляции ядра (по крайней мере 2.4.xx) нужна следущая последовательность действий:

make clean
make oldconfig
[add extraversion parameter]
make config/xconfig/menuconfig
make dep
make
make bzImage ( а надо ли?)
make modules
make modules_install
make install
mkinitrd
lilo

есть ли тут что-то лишниее? И какая последовательность будет для ядра 2.6.xx (там, вроде, некоторые шаги как deprecated помечены)?

best regards..

★★★

да

для 2.6 просто
$ make
$ sudo make modules_install install

make строит и ядро и модули. make dep - в прошлом. лилу тебе /sbin/installkernel (make install) предложит запустить, если найдет.

rihad
()

Зачем нужен make oldconfig?

Один мой знакомый как-то не смог собрать нормально работающее ядро,

используя make oldconfig. Пока не сделал make xconfig.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.